The fashion industry honored the late Karl Lagerfeld at the Chanel Paris Fashion Week show on March 4. The event drew in attendees such as Anna Wintour and Naomi Campbell and had models crying down the runway as they remembered the designer, who created the ski resort winter wonderland set before he passed on February 19.

Guests received a card that had a sketch designed by Karl of the creative director and the brands' founder, Coco Chanel. Above the drawing were the words, “The beat goes on.”

The models did their final walk as the song “Heroes” by David Bowie played. Many of them could be seen in tears as they took their last steps at Karl’s last show.
